President Donald Trump said Monday the initial strikes targeting Iran killed dozens of Iranian leaders during a breakfast meeting with Iranian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ei.

Trump confirmed Khamenei’s death in a post on Truth Social Saturday, hours after he announced the commencement of Operation Epic Fury early that morning. “Special Report” host Bret Baier told “America’s Newsroom” co-hosts Bill Hemmer and Dana Perino that Trump was “pleased” with the progress of Operation Epic Fury.

“I said this is, it’s a tough succession plan in Iran. He said 49 L is deep, it’s very deep. When they met, they met for breakfast. They assumed it was good for a lot of reasons,” Baier said. “’Number one, they didn’t think we knew, but you never attack in the morning, having to do with winds and sun and a lot of things. It just, it was amazing that we knew everything we knew,’ he said there is a plan.”

On Monday, CENTCOM reported that a fourth American servicemember had died from wounds suffered in the initial Iranian attacks.

“I asked, ‘so what you’re saying is that you know there is somebody on the ground in Iran that is going to rise up,’ Quote, ‘Yes, I feel there is, feel that, and some of them are no longer with us, to be honest, because it was 49 leaders that were taken out. That was going to take four weeks,’” Baier continued. “’We thought to get rid of the Iranian leadership, and it’s always, you know, if they hide, it’s a lot longer than four weeks, and they would have been hiding. We were shocked when we heard what was going on. We knew exactly what was happening and where 49 leaders, and you know they’re talking about using people now that nobody ever heard of, even though they don’t know. They’re using people, studying people to be the leader that even they don’t know who they are. Can they? Can you believe that?’”

“He points to Venezuela as a template, which means to me that going in they had some sense on the ground of what was coming next,” Baier added.

Secretary of War Pete Hegseth said during a Monday Pentagon briefing that the Trump administration would not rule out putting U.S. troops on the ground in Iran.
